 Effects of early Wnt signaling modulation on neural crest marker expression. ISH for dlx2a at 18 s stage. (A,B) Control sibling embryos and embryos with increased Wnt signaling (hsp70l:wnt8a-GFP+). The anterior 1st and 2nd neural crest streams are fused and the 3rd is expanded, consistent with posteriorization of the embryo. (C,D) Control sibling embryos and embryos with decreased Wnt signaling (hsp70l:dkk1-GFP+). The neural crest cells were minimally affected after loss of Wnt signaling. Images are dorsal views. Anterior is up. ≥ 15 embryos were examined per condition. Scale bar indicates 100 μm.  |
